The Moon Illusion

The summer moon often plays many tricks on your eyes. When rises in the east it appears very large when it first peaks over the horizon. This is what is referred to as the moon illusion. When you first see the moon it looks incredibly big to the human eye but oddly enough cameras don’t see it but your eyes do; this is the real illusion.

No matter what position in the sky the moon is it is always the exact same size, as of why this illusion occurs.. Scientist are still not 100% sure. One thingis for sure, the best time to view this illusion is when the moon first rise!

Static Movement Optical Illusion

Static Movement Optical Illusion shows a simple image that is a static jpg, that appears to be waving around like a flag. This illusion is caused but the light and dark edges along the side of the bean shaped objects, as your eyes move from side to side of the image it, the dark/light borders cause yours eyes to shift giving it the illusion of motion.

10 Incredible Driftwood Horses

These 10 Incredible Driftwood Horses have all been hand crafted out of large pieces of driftwood. the mastermind behind this beautiful pieces of art is Heather Jansch. Heather being the horse loving, never letting anything slow her down kinda girl began building these horse sculptures and now has a full gallery and exhibition of them. Heather has even started to build bronze sculptures of these magnificent creatures.

Never ending Bridge Optical Illusion

The Never ending Bridge Optical Illusion is mural painted at the end of a bridge, it gives the illusion that the bridge goes on for ever, its very deceiving an even tricked the person who took the photos originally!

These type of murals are based on perspective and placed in areas then when looked at from the right direction give some incredible illusions. Perceptions illusions are some of my favorite and can change in an instance depending the angle you are viewing them in.
